Gaps in {sigma(n)}...

Let S=\{\sigma(n),n\in\mathbb{N}^*\}.
For all L\in\mathbb{N}, can we find a\in\mathbb{N} such that [a,a+L] \cap S=\emptyset?

Here is my advance, not much but is better than nothing:

Let L be a number such that \{a,a+1,...,a+L-1\}\cap S=\emptyset for some a. Then we know the following:

L=1\Rightarrow a_{min}=2
L\in\{2,3\}\Rightarrow a_{min}=9
L\in\{4,5\}\Rightarrow a_{min}=49
L\in\{6,7,8,9\}\Rightarrow a_{min}=423
L\in\{10,11\}\Rightarrow a_{min}=1333
L\geq 12\Rightarrow a_{min}>1333
